#e6604c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#e6604c is composed of 90.2% red, 37.6% green and 29.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 58.3% magenta, 67% yellow and 9.8% black. It has a hue angle of 7.8 degrees, a saturation of 75.5% and a lightness of 60%. #e6604c color hex could be obtained by blending #ffc098 with #cd0000. Closest websafe color is: #ff6633.

#e6604c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#e6604c has RGB values of R:230, G:96, B:76 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.58, Y:0.67, K:0.1. Its decimal value is 15097932.
